Software Engineer - Forest, VA

Signode

Software Engineer - Forest, VA

Forest, VA
Full Time
Paid
  • Responsibilities

    Job Description

    Benefits:

    Signode offers a comprehensive benefits package to full-time employees, which includes health, dental, vision, 401k, paid time off, life insurance, wellness perks, and more. Benefits begin the month following the hire date.

    Salary:

    Starting at $89,000

    Summary:

    A Software Engineer performs software design, developmental and testing duties for electro-mechanical automation devices and machines for the electronics, optical, personal care and pharmaceutical industries.

    Essential Functions:

    • Develop new product concepts and designs
    • Prototype and evaluate new product ideas
    • Investigate new software technologies and tools
    • Support products and interact with customers through the beta period, including training
    • Help Customer Support with technical content for product manuals
    • Full lifecycle application development
    • Designing, coding and debugging applications in C# and C++ using Microsoft Visual Studio
    • Software modeling and simulation.
    • Front end graphical user interface design.
    • Software testing and quality assurance.
    • Performance tuning and improvement.
    • Support, maintain and document software functionality.
    • Integrate software with existing systems (working with controls engineers and communicating with many different types of industrial devices) .
    • Evaluate and identify new technologies for implementation.
    • Maintain standards of compliance for coding.
    • Travel is required for this role, depending on the project, estimated at 30%.
    • Other duties as needed or assigned.
  • Qualifications

    Qualifications

    Education:

    Minimum BS degree in Computer Science or minimum of 5 years' experience in C# or C++ development for industrial automation.

    Experience:

    • Experience with BOTH C# and C++
    • Automation/electromechanical experience
    • Experience with machine vision is a plus
    • Experience with microcontrollers (such as Arduinos) is a plus
    • A deep understanding of advanced mathematics such as Calculus and Linear Algebra is a plus

    Functional Success Drivers: These competencies are what we require for an individual to be successful in this role.

    • Result Orientated
    • Analysis Skills
    • Problem Solving
    • Time Management
    • Organizational
    • Priority Setting

    Additional Information

    All your information will be kept confidential according to EEO guidelines.

    Reasonable Accommodation Statement

    To perform this job successfully, the individual must be able to perform each essential duty satisfactorily. Reasonable Accommodations may be made to enable qualified individuals with disabilities.

    __

    The Company has reviewed this job description to ensure that essential functions and basic duties have been included. It is intended to provide guidelines for job expectations and the employee's ability to perform the position described. It is not intended to be construed as an exhaustive list of all functions, responsibilities, skills and abilities. Additional functions and requirements may be assigned by supervisors as deemed appropriate. This document does not represent a contract of employment, and the Company reserves the right to change this job description and/or assign tasks for the employee to perform, as the Company may deem appropriate.

    __

    Signode Industrial Group, LLC is an Equal Opportunity /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ability or protected veteran status.